The March 4 & 5 snowstorm that dumped around a foot of snow on the Twin Cities completely missed the area where the Zumbro Endurance Run is held. The March 19 snowstorm that hit southern Minnesota / northern Iowa also missed “Zumbro” for the most part, with only around 1″ of snow accumulating. The trails are coming around, and hopefully the old adage for March holds true… “in like a lion, out like a lamb”. That said “April showers bring May flowers”, so as always, prepare for any / everything at Zumbro; it could be the normal course with dry trails (Saturday last year was like zero humidity and temps that topped out near 80F) or we could get rain and snow between now and the race forcing us onto the Highwater Course and include mud, ice, frigid water crossings, etc. As always, if Zumbro wants to Zumbro, it’s going to Zumbro. Either way, I am knocking on wood and hoping for the best, and even if we get prime conditions, we always have the sand to provide that extra challenge.

After a three year hiatus in order to do some different hat styles, we are back to t-shirts for 2025. We are very excited about these! All registered runners and volunteers will receive one of these t-shirts.
The eastern Gray Squirrel, who has cameoed in past Zumbro art, was the inspiration for this years t-shirt. Anytime I take a run at Zumbro on a quiet / windless day I enjoy the sounds, near and far, of squirrels rustling in the leaves on the ground, and performing their acrobatics in the tree canopy above. The Zumbro Endurance Run takes place in the Zumbro Bottoms Management Unit which resides within the Richard J. Dorer Memorial Hardwood Forest – an expansive 1.7 million acre tract of Minnesota hardwood forest on the Northern edge of the Driftless Region. Eastern Gray Squirrels play a crucial role in Minnesota’s hardwood forests by acting as seed dispersers, helping to regenerate tree populations through their caching and forgetting behaviors, which lead to the planting of seeds in new locations.
